Planning your perfect Caribbean escape? Numerous travelers choose the convenience and comfort of all-inclusive resorts, and for a very good reason. These resorts provide a fantastic package: tasty meals, exotic drinks, thrilling activities, and pleasant accommodations—all rolled into a single price. Featuring family-friendly options with youngst… Read More